Enclosure.

Report by the Attorney General on Ordinance No:26 of 1886.

ATTORNEY GENERAL'S OFFICE,

14th December 1886.

I have examined the accompanying Ordinance, entitled "An Ordinance to Amend the Law relating to Wills;" and I am of opinion that the Ordinance is one which is not contrary to the Governor's Instructions.

This Ordinance enacts at length the provisions of 15 and 16 Vict: Ch: 24 which had been extended to this Colony by Ordinance 3 of 1854.

Sd Edw. J. Ackroyd,

Acting Attorney General.
